Green Hope has gone 7-1 against Athens Drive recently and they'll look to pad the win column further on Friday. The Green Hope Falcons will hit the road for the first time this season to face off against the Athens Drive Jaguars at 7:00 p.m. Both teams took a loss in their last game, so they'll have plenty of motivation to get the 'W'.
Green Hope is leaving town to face Athens Drive after disappointing their home crowd in their season opener. Green Hope fell just short of Ravenscroft by a score of 22-20 on Friday. The Falcons gained 192 more yards on the day, but it was the Ravens that made the best use of them.
Despite the defeat, Green Hope had strong showings from Joe Lopez, who rushed for 105 yards and a touchdown, and Mar'Kee Jackson, who picked up 140 receiving yards and a touchdown.
Meanwhile, Athens Drive had to start their season on the road on Friday, and it wasn't the start they were hoping for. They lost to Ashley on the road by a 34-16 margin.
The loss doesn't tell the whole story though, as several players had good games. One of the most active was Jack Danjczek, who rushed for 59 yards, and also threw for 153 yards while completing 88.9% of his passes. A healthy portion of that aerial production (138 yards to be exact) went to Derek Crumpton.
Green Hope couldn't quite finish off Athens Drive in their previous matchup back in August of 2023 and fell 36-34. Can Green Hope av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
